Replying to: dairyshick (Sep 03, 2006 8:14 am) First, no sunroof keeps the weight and cost down. (and the added weight is at an awkward location). Second, fewer options (you'll notice virtually NO factory options outside of NAV in the Grand Touring model) means simplified assembly line. Third, Mazda probably figures (correctly) that initial demand means they'll have no problem selling every unit they make, regardless of whether or not it has a sunroof. If they were trying to unload 25k units, yeah, a sunroof would probably need to be an option. But they're only looking to sell 5k units for the '07 MY. I would not be surprised to see the sunroof appear as an option next year (assuming the Speed3 comes back for '08). IOWs, if you don't buy a Speed3 due to a lack of a sunroof, there's probably 3 guys in line right behind you who don't give a rip. |
